As part of our goal for providing relevant activities, C.A.S.T.L.E. clubs, athletics, and programs all teach ideas and principles that will be useful during life after high school. In order to participate in any extracurriculars, students must maintain Good Academic Standing (G.P.A. of 2.5) and good attendance. C.A.S.T.L.E. Extracurricular Activities

At C.A.S.T.L.E. we believe in the importance of athletic programs to encourage physical activity, teamwork and the application of innate athletic talents. Currently, we offer:
C.A.S.T.L.E. High School is part of the Ohio Charter School Athletic Association (OCSAA). C.A.S.T.L.E. has played an instrumental role in the establishment of charter school sports in Northeast Ohio. Home games take place at the Boys and Girls Club on Broadway in Cleveland.
Men's Basketball 2006/2007 City/Regional Champions among Northeast Ohio Charter Schools. Competed in the State 2007/2008 City/Regional Champions among Northeast Ohio Charter Schools. Competed in the State For the team schedule and record, visit the OCSAA website.

C.A.S.T.L.E. Programs The C.A.S.T.L.E. High School Rites of Passage program is an 11th grade program designed to introduce students to the ancient and contemporary African and African American History with an emphasis on the visual, and performing arts. In this program, the values of Self-awareness, Respect, Spirituality, Economic Development, Community Responsibility are promoted.
